Career path

Career Role (Instructional Design & Sales Training) Description
Sales Training Manager Develop and deliver engaging sales training programs, leveraging instructional design principles to boost sales team performance. Oversee training budgets and resources.
Learning & Development Consultant (Sales Focus) Design and implement bespoke sales training solutions for various clients. Conduct needs analysis, develop learning materials, and evaluate training effectiveness. Requires strong instructional design and sales methodology expertise.
Instructional Designer (Sales Enablement) Focus on creating impactful learning experiences for sales professionals using a variety of methods, including eLearning, workshops and simulations. Strong project management skills and alignment with sales strategies are key.
Sales Training Specialist Deliver engaging and effective sales training programs. Maintain training materials, track progress, and provide ongoing support to sales teams.

A Postgraduate Certificate in Instructional Design for Sales Training equips professionals with the skills to create engaging and effective sales training programs. This specialized program focuses on applying instructional design principles specifically within a sales context, leading to improved sales performance and team productivity.


Learning outcomes typically include mastering instructional design methodologies like ADDIE and SAM, developing learning objectives aligned with sales goals, designing various training materials (e.g., presentations, e-learning modules, role-playing scenarios), and evaluating training effectiveness using appropriate metrics. You'll also gain expertise in utilizing technology for delivering sales training, such as learning management systems (LMS) and virtual reality (VR) tools.
